36 =over 4
37
38 =item $Message::MIME::EncodedWord::OPTION{forcedecode} = 1/0
39
40 When no charset decoder (See L<Message::MIME::Charset>)
41 for C<ISO-8859-I<n>> is defined, and this option is TRUE,
42 decoding C<encoded-word> functions attempt to decode
43 ASCII part of these charset.
44
45 RFC 2047 says that ASCII part of C<ISO-8859-I<n>> be at least
46 supported. This requirement is convinience for human user who
47 sees final rendering result. But it is not appropriate to process message.
48
49 Defalt value is C<0>, force decoding is disenabled.
50
51 =back
52
53 =head2 Note
54
55 Before you set new value for these options,
56 C<Message::MIME::EncodedWord> should be loaded (C<require>ed).
57 Other modules which use C<Message::MIME::EncodedWord>
58 will automatically require this module, and this module
59 will set initial (default) option value.
60
61 Bad example:
62
63 #! perl
64 $Message::MIME::EncodedWord::OPTION{forcedecode} = 0;
65 use Message::Field::Subject;
66 my $subject = Message::Field::Subject->parse ($ARGV[0]);
67 ## At this time, M::F::Subject call M::M::EWord,
68 ## and $OPTION{forcedecode} is set C<1>, default value.
69
70 Shold be:
71
72 #! perl
73 require Message::MIME::EncodedWord;
74 $Message::MIME::EncodedWord::OPTION{forcedecode} = 0;
75 use Message::Field::Subject;
76 my $subject = Message::Field::Subject->parse ($ARGV[0]);
77 ## At this time, M::F::Subject call M::M::EWord,
78 ## but perl takes no action since it has already loaded.
79

178 =head1 $encoded_words = Message::MIME::EncodedWord::encode ($string, %option)
179
180 Encode given string as encoded-words if necessary.
181
182 Available options:
183
184 =over 4
185
186 =item -charset => charset (default: 'us-ascii')
187
188 Charset name (in lower cases) to be used to encode the output string.
189 (Currently 'us-ascii', 'iso-8859-1' and 'us-ascii' is supported.
190 'iso-2022-int', 'euc-jp' or other charsets are unable to co-exist with
191 encoded-words, in current implemention.)
192
193 =item -context => 'default' (default) / 'comment' / 'phrase' / 'quoted_string'
194
195 Context in which given string is embeded.
196
197 =item -ebcdic_safe => 0/1 (default)
198
199 Encode additional ASCII characters (shown in RFC 2047) that
200 are not safe in EBCDIC transports. This option is meaningful only when
201 "Q" encoding is used.
202
203 =item -encode_char => 1*CHAR / '' (default)
204
205 The list of ASCII characters should be encoded in encoded-word
206 in addition to non-ASCII characters and special ASCII characters
207 determined by C<-context> and C<-ebcdic_safe> options.
208
209 =item -encode_encoded_word_like => 0/1 (default)
210
211 Encode encoded-word-like tokens in given string or not.
212
213 =item -preserve_wsp => 0/1 (default)
214
215 If true, 2*WSP is encoded in encoded-word. Unless string is the content
216 of comment or quoted-string, this option value should be true.
217
218 =item -q_encode_char => 1*CHAR / '' (default)
219
220 The list of ASCII characters should be encoded in q encoding of encoded-word
221 in addition to non-ASCII characters and special ASCII characters
222 determined by C<-context> and C<-ebcdic_safe> options.
223
224 =item -quoted_pair => 1*CHAR / qr|(:: pattern ::)| '' (default)
225
226 A character list or a Regexp pattern for characters to be quoted as
227 the quoted-pairs. When '', no character is quoted.
228 Quoting is performed to characters NOT encoded as encoded-words.
229 This option should be useful if given string is to be a content
230 of a comment or quoted-string. Usually, "\" is also included in
231 the character list to represent "\" itself as "\\".
232
233 =item -source_charset => charset (default = *internal)
234
235 Charset name (in lower case) of given string.
236
237 =item -token_maxlength => 1*DIGIT / 0 (default)
238
239 Maximal length of a string (1*l<OCTET except WSP>) that can be represented
240 as a non-encoded-word. If 0, no length limit is implied.
241 Note that this option does NOT change maximal length of encoded-word.
242 (Maximal length of encoded-word is always 75, as defined in RFC 2047.)
243
244 =cut
